KOTA KINABALU: Sabah Chief Minister Datuk Seri Mohd Shafie Apdal has asked critics to move on and not continue harping on the appointment of a "non-Sabahan" as a nominated assemblyman.
Commenting on the backlash following Penang-born Loh Ee Eng's appointment under DAP's quota, Shafie said it did not go against the Sabah constitution.
